Transaction 6428628630e7a6aa3e0fe26546446bf1ef2b7a5cc1f048f6f64d0f17aa9bf2de

1 Input
2 Outputs
  • 6428628630e7a6aa3e0fe26546446bf1ef2b7a5cc1f048f6f64d0f17aa9bf2de:0
  • value  29199000
    address  3KHFJVEoAnquvrzpYpYxMrfpWedpvwo8Gu
  • 6428628630e7a6aa3e0fe26546446bf1ef2b7a5cc1f048f6f64d0f17aa9bf2de:1
  • value  91321055
    address  3MixKPGnDtz9LbdhBWUXDFGxRASiDqGvf1